Adversarial Learning for MRI Reconstruction and Classification of Cognitively Impaired Individuals

2023-11-20

Abstract excerpt

Game theory-inspired deep learning using a generative adversarial network provides an environment to competitively interact and accomplish a goal. In the context of medical imaging, most work has focused on achieving single tasks such as improving image resolution, segmenting images, and correcting motion artifacts.
